Thinsulate Surface Technology

Thinsulate is a mix of polypropylene, which provides the high-frequency noise absorption, and polyester, which makes the material compressible.

Applications of Thinsulate have included door panels, headliners, wheel wells, pillars, and instrument panels. For hybrids, it is used in the same locations but also can be applied around hybrid-specific parts such as electric motors, power electronics, etc.
